Book Description Paperback. Garth traces Graham McKenzie's brilliant career, from his idyllic childhood in a beachside suburb to the very pinnacle of international sporting stardom. The boy from Cottesloe inspired a generation of young cricketers, and played a part in transforming his home State from a perennial 'also-ran' into a major force in Australian cricket. 1993.
